Result of appeal held before Deputy President King of the Racing Appeals Tribunal on 17 July 2014.

Ricky Frearson

Against a 6 month suspension of which 3 months was suspended for a period of 12 months.  This suspension was handed down by stewards after Mr. Frearson provided a urine same, which upon analysis, contained the banned substance 11-nor-delta-9-tetrahydrocannabinol-9-carboxylic acid (cannabis).

Result

Penalty varied to 24 weeks suspension of which 3 months was suspended for a period of 12 months.  In varying penalty, the Tribunal took into account the 14 days Mr. Frearson was stood down pending the result of a clear urine sample.

Mr. Frearson will resume driving on Tuesday 2 September 2014.
